What does Nigeria import from USA?

Nigerian imports from the U.S. include wheat, vehicles, spare parts and machinery, refined petroleum products, military hardware.

What do Nigerians import the most?

Nigeria’s Top 10 Imports

  • Machinery including computers: US$9.9 billion (18.6\% of total imports)
  • Mineral fuels including oil: $8.2 billion (15.4\%)
  • Vehicles: $5.3 billion (10.1\%)
  • Electrical machinery, equipment: $3.7 billion (7\%)
  • Pharmaceuticals: $2.8 billion (5.3\%)
  • Plastics, plastic articles: $2.4 billion (4.5\%)
